What is Jane?
Headquartered in Lehi, Utah, Jane.com operates as a sophisticated online boutique marketplace. The platform distinguishes itself by aggregating a diverse array of women's fashion trends, home decor, and children's clothing, effectively bridging the gap between independent sellers and a broad consumer base. By providing a centralized digital storefront, the company facilitates a seamless shopping experience that prioritizes variety and trend-conscious curation.

How much funding has Jane raised?
Jane has raised a total of $40M across 1 funding round:
Private Equity
$40M
Private Equity (2020): $40M with participation from Tritium Partners LLC
Key Investors in Jane
Tritium Partners LLC
A private equity firm focused on investing in and growing lower middle-market companies in the internet and software sectors.
